There are still two episodes left this season on HBO’s Game of Thrones, and eight episodes overall before the show ends for good — but one big question about the Iron Throne has been already answered.
In this past week’s installment, “Eastwatch,” Gilly (Hannah Murray) casually dropped one of the single most important reveals we’ve ever experienced on the show: Jon Snow (Kit Harington) is a legitimate Targaryen, the product of the official marriage of Lyanna Stark and Prince Rhaegar. That means of all the contenders for the Iron Throne, Jon Snow is the one with the best claim. It’s yet another feather in the cap of a man with a long list of unspoken titles, but is it a feather he wants? That’s a question for another day.
